NoahScheitler Posted March 7 Share Posted March 7 Hello, I was just wondering if it is possible to set bleeds to always output as a certain number. For example having 9pt bleeds be the standard upon outputting rather than 0pt. I thought perhaps you could set a global variable of some sort? Dan Korn Posted March 7 Share Posted March 7 Which bleed setting do you mean? On the Imposition tab of the Composition Settings dialog? Or in FP Imposer? Or in the Export dialog in InDesign? By default, FusionPro will set the Bleed in the Composition Settings to match the difference between the Bleed and Trim boxes on the first page of the template PDF file. But you can change it in the Composition Settings, or, if you're imposing, in FP Imposer, to add more space for variable elements.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
